ESCENA GOLF CLUB IS OPEN FOR PLAY! Blending championship golf with a classic Palm Springs setting, a round at Escena Golf Club is as much about the surroundings as it is about unforgettable golf. The towering San Jacinto Mountains and blue desert skies frame the flight of every tee shot. Abundant palm trees, native desert landscaping and dramatic waterscapes add to the sensory feast as you wind your way through this stunning oasis. A meal or a drink in the stunning mid-century environs of the Escena Grill is a perfect way to round out your day. Of course, the golf is memorable, too. Ranked as the #6 Public Course in California by PGATOUR.com, this Nicklaus Design golf course is noted for its unobstructed sightlines, generous driving corridors and the overall strength of its design. Strategically placed bunkers, water hazards and undulating greens are there before you, but at the same time there is ample room for you to decide how much you want to flirt with them. With back tees stretching to nearly 7,200 yards, Escena offers a formidable test for the skilled player, but with four sets of tees and room to roam, how you satisfy your personal appetite for challenge is entirely up to you. A luxurious lifestyle meets a playful landscape in Rancho Mirage. Several past U.S. Presidents, including Gerald Ford, Richard Nixon, and Barack Obama, have unplugged here, finding peace amid the palm trees and earning the city the nickname “playground of presidents.” And it truly is a playground. Kids can explore more than 80 hands-on exhibits at the Children’s Museum of the Desert; couples can reach for the stars at the city’s new state-of-the-art observatory, where a research-grade CDK 300 telescope allows visitors to gaze into distant galaxies; and families can shop, dine, and catch a flick all in the same day at Greater Palm Springs’ only waterfront shopping and entertainment hub, The River.

[Due to COVID-19 restrictions, Sunylands is temporarily closed] Sunnylands, a 200-acre midcentury modern estate, reopened in March 2012 as The Annenberg Retreat at Sunnylands, welcoming national and international leaders for high-level retreats and meetings that address serious issues facing the nation and world. The former winter home of Ambassadors Walter and Leonore Annenberg is available also for limited public tours with purchase of a ticket. Admission to the adjacent Sunnylands Center & Gardens is free. It features art exhibitions, films, and educational programs. Visitors may also enjoy the cafe and a nine-acre garden. Sunnylands is open Wednesday through Sunday, 8:30 am to 4:00 pm.

Takes place in February Here is a bit of history Tim Esser had an idea on January 31, 1998. He would hold a bike event in Palm Springs that would allow local cyclist to ride 5, 15, 25 and 50 miles. 400 cyclists rode in the first event, known at that time as Spokes for Different Folks. Tim, however, being the guy that never goes only part way, decided to use the event as a launch pad for his own personal ride across America. It took him 30 days to cross the country from Palm Springs, California to Jacksonville, Florida. When it was all over Tim had survived his chase vehicle crashing and catching on fire, a fall that sprained his shoulder, rain in the valleys, snow in the mountains and tornadoes on the plains! But, he made it. Mother Son Tour de Palm RidersThe first event raised $20,000 and was hailed as a great success by all who participated. Tim, along with his mother Fran, set up a not for profit organization called CVSPIN. Even though many cyclists may think that CVSPIN means to turn over their bicycle pedals as fast as possible in the Coachella Valley, it actually stands for Coachella Valley Serving People In Need. The first Tour de Palm Springs was held in 1999. The number of riders exceeded 1,000 and a 100 mile (century) ride was added. In 2001, the Coachella Valley Desert Business Association recognized the Tour de Palm Springs as the best event in the Valley. The competition included the Bob Hope PGA Tournament, the Dinah Shore LPGA Tournament, The Skins Game and the Tennis Masters Series.Every year the Tour de Palm Springs continues to attract more and more riders. The money generated has gone to help many organizations in the Coachella Valley. In 2015 over $179,000 was donated to 80 local charities that in their own special ways met the varied needs of the people in the Coachella Valley. More info: https://tourdepalmsprings.com/

February The mission of Modernism Week is to celebrate and foster appreciation of midcentury architecture and design, as well as contemporary thinking in these fields, by encouraging education, preservation and sustainable modern living as represented in the greater Palm Springs area. Modernism Week’s signature February Event is an annual celebration of midcentury modern design, architecture, art, fashion and culture. This exciting festival takes place in February in the Palm Springs area of Southern California. Modernism Week features more than 350 events including the Modernism Show & Sale, Signature Home Tours, films, lectures, Premier Double Decker Architectural Bus Tours, nightly parties and live music, walking and bike tours, tours of Sunnylands, fashion, classic cars, modern garden tours, a vintage travel trailer exhibition, and more. In addition to the events in February, Modernism Week hosts the “Fall Preview” weekend in October. Partner organizations collaborate to produce a “mini-Modernism Week” to kick-off the active social and recreational season in Palm Springs. Modernism Week is also a charitable organization, providing scholarships to local students pursuing college educations in the fields of architecture and design; as well as supporting local and state preservation organizations and neighborhood groups in their efforts to preserve modernist architecture throughout the state of California.

February More info: https://www.datefest.org/ History Of The Riverside County Fair & National Date Festival The Riverside County Fair & National Date Festival is located in Indio, an oasis situated in the vast California desert, approximately 130 miles east from Los Angeles. The Fair started as a festival to celebrate the end of the annual date harvest in the Coachella Valley, the major commercial date-producing area in the western hemisphere. Dates were an unknown commodity in the valley until 1903 when date palms were transplanted here from Algeria. By the early 1920’s, enough acreage was planted to make dates a major crop for the area. In fact, the date industry represented Riverside County at the 1915 World’s Fair in San Francisco. Date groves in the Coachella Valley were such a novelty that they became quite a tourist attraction. With the popularity of the date gardens, the idea was planted for a date festival to be held in Indio City Park in 1921. The heavily publicized International Festival of Dates was promoted with an Arabian theme, a reference to the ancestral homeland of the date. A second festival was held the following year, but the interest for an annual fair waned. Instead, date agriculturalists promoted the crop at events such as the Southern California Fair in Riverside, the California State Fair and the Golden Gate International Exposition. In 1937, the idea for an annual date festival came forth again and the Riverside County Board of Supervisors contracted the Indio Civic Club to organize and promote a third date festival. The newly re-named Riverside County Fair and the Coachella Valley Date Festival opened in 1938, drawing in 72 local vendors and over 5,000 attendants. An elaborate parade was staged through Indio that year featuring over 500 mounted entries along the then-unpaved Deglet Noor Street, beginning a tradition that continues to this year. Fair and parade attendants were encouraged to don Western apparel to fit the fair’s theme that year, which included wiskerenos, cowboy hats and rodeo events. In 1940, the County invested $10,000 on 40 acres for the establishment of permanent fairgrounds. The grounds were expanded with the purchase of an additional 40 acres--including the date grove--eventually reaching its present-day size of 120 acres. Ground broke for construction on September 27, 1941, though all fair activity came to a halt in 1942 with World War II. After the war, Robert M.C. Fullenwider was hired to manage the Riverside County Fair & National Date Festival. Fullenwider envisioned an Arabian Nights theme tying in the county fair with the desert region and date industry and as a nod to the 1921 International Festival of Dates. Although many community members donated their time and energy to the Fair, two individuals made indelible marks with their creative contributions: writer and artist Louise Dardenelle, and retired Hollywood set designer Harry Oliver. Both were intrigued with the Arabian Nights theme. Ms. Dardenelle conceived the idea for an Arabian nights pageant, finishing a first draft before her death in 1947. Harry Oliver designed and supervised construction of the Fair’s Old Baghdad State, which was finished just in time for the first production of the fair’s first pageant in 1948. Under the direction of producer and choreographer Roy Randolph, Prince Khudadad in the Shadow of Destiny became an iconic feature of the Fair’s history. Today, the Riverside County Fair & National Date Festival remains an integral part of the greater Coachella Valley community and a major tourist attraction. It continues the legacy of decades-old desert traditions while celebrating our history and community, and of course, providing fun and excitement for everyone.

This one is still on my list....I have heard wonderful things about this museum.. Cabot's Pueblo Museum is a historical house museum consisting of a large, Hopi-style pueblo home. The house is a stunning example of the Pueblo revival style and was built by Cabot Yerxa, an explorer and activist who constructed the home out of things he found in the desert. Every part of the house is manmade using sun-dried bricks and reclaimed wood from nearby cabins. The construction began in 1941 and Yerxa worked on the home until he died in 1965. All in all, the house is four stories tall and has 35 rooms. He and his wife opened the house to the public for touring during his life, and today it stands as a museum with artifacts, artwork, and items from the architect’s own personal life. 67616 Desert View Avenue, Desert Hot Springs, CA 92240, Phone: 760-329-7610
